crm 2011 remove create new for some users RRS feed

  • Question

  • Hi all,

         I have a custom product and i dont want allow one system administrator user to create new product. plz help me to find the solution.



    Thanks in Advance Siva

    Thursday, June 7, 2012 2:38 PM

All replies

  • Since you have already assign the System Administrator role to that user, you can't restrict the create permission for the product only to that user.

    One of the solution is to create a custom security role (e.g. User Administrator) and grant all the permissions except Create permission of the product. But there is a loophole in that solution that such user can just update his own role grant the create permission to Product entity or simply assign the System Admin role to himself and do whatever he can.

    So, another foolproof but more difficult option is to write a plugin for the pre event of Create message in Product entity to check the domain login of the current user and throw and error if it matches to the names configured in the unsecure configuration.

    Thursday, June 7, 2012 3:51 PM
  • nothing can be done if a person have a system admin role .

    Linn is exactly right

    Ahmed - CRM Application Management

    Tuesday, June 12, 2012 6:45 PM